Penapis Zarah Deret Masa

Penapis zarah deret masa ialah kaedah Monte Carlo Sekuen (Sequential Monte Carlo) yang menjejak keadaan tersembunyi bagi model ruang keadaan tak linear, tak Gaussian apabila pemerhatian baharu diterima satu demi satu. Ia mewakili taburan posterior yang berkembang ke atas keadaan laten sebagai awan sampel rawak (zarah) yang diberi pemberat, mengemas kininya pada setiap langkah masa melalui perambatan, pemberatan kebarangkalian, dan pensampelan semula.
